Alpha-Decay Studies in the Heavy-Element Region

Description: Using primarily a 75-cm radius of curvature 60 deg symmetrical electromagnetic analyzer, a study of the complexity of the following alpha spectra was made: Es/sup 253/, Cf/sup 246/, Cm/sup 244/, Am/sup 243/, Pu/sup 236,242/, Pa/sup 231/ , Th/sup 227,230/, Ac/sup 225/, At/sup 209/ and Po/sup 206/. An investigation of the gamma rays associated with the following isotopes was also madei /sup 236/, and Pa/sup 231/. Decay schemes have been suggested for most of the isotopes included in this study. Angular Distribution of Photopions From Hydrogen

Description: ABS>An accurate measurement of the differential cross section for the photoproduction of positive pions was made at the Berkeley synchrotron, for photon energies of 280 and 290 Mev. The mesons were produced in a thin-walled liquid hydrogen target, and the meson detection apparatus utilized the characteristic pi -- mu decay of the meson. The Radiation Chemistry of the Symmetrical Dichloroethylenes

Description: Purified, degassed samples of cis- and trans-1,2dichloroethylene were irradiated in glass cells with 48Mev helium ions at energy inputs up to 10/sup 21/ ev/cc. The principal volatile radiolysis products are acetylene, hydrogen chloride, chloroacetylene, vinyl chloride, hydrogen, and dichloroacetylene, in order of decreasing yield. Analysis of Current Distribution in Electrolytic Cells With Flowing Mercury Cathodes

Description: An idealized model is postulated embodying the essential features of industrial caustic-chlorine cells with horizontal flowing-mercury cathodes. This model is examined in detail, and relations expressing the local anode potential, cathode potential, and ohmic potential drop in the electrolyte in terms of local current density and other parameters are established. Mutual Charge Neutralization of Gaseous Ions

Description: The problem of the bimolecular rate constant, alpha , for the mutual charge neutralization reaction (ion-ion recombination) for ions formed by the vacuum ultraviolet photolysis of nitric oxide is considered. The pressure dependence of alpha over a pressure range of 10 to 600 torr for mixtures of a few hundred microns of NO with He, Ar, Kr, Xe, H/sub 2/, D/sub 2/, and N/sub 2/ was measured. Calculations of the ground state energy and exchange integrals of crystalline $sup 3$He

Description: Thesis. The variational equation is derived and discussed using Jastrowtype wave functions, which are a product of pair wave functions, as the trail wave function. The various approximations used in simplifying the variational equations so as to obtain a form that is possible to solve numerically are discussed also. A Monte Carlo calculation is described using the wave function obtained. Exchange in /sup 3/He is discussed. (MHR)
